Taxes, Assessments and Other Governmental Charges. The Authority shall promptly pay and discharge, as the same become due, all taxes and assessments, general and special, and other governmental charges of any kind whatsoever that may be lawfully taxed, charged, levied, assessed or imposed upon or against or be payable for or in respect of the Project, or any part thereof or interest therein (including the leasehold estate of the Sponsors therein) or any buildings, improvements, machinery and equipment at any time installed thereon by the Sponsors, or the income therefrom or Sponsor Payments and other amounts payable under this Agreement, including any new taxes and assessments not of the kind enumerated above to the extent that the same are lawfully made, levied or assessed in lieu of or in addition to taxes or assessments now customarily levied against real or personal property, and further including all utility charges, assessments and other general governmental charges and impositions whatsoever, foreseen or unforeseen, which if not paid when due would encumber the Authority’s title to the Project.
